Jump to content
php.lv forumi

GedroX

Reģistrētie lietotāji
  • Posts

    373
  • Joined

  • Last visited

Everything posted by GedroX

  1. GedroX

    PHP errors

    Izmanto if (!function_exists('connect') { function connect(){ ... } } ...vai arī vienmēr lieto include_once(), require_once() funkcijas.
  2. GedroX

    myltipart post

    kaa var dabuut binary image source??!;) Atver failu ar jebkādu teksta redaktoru vai izmanto php functiju file_get_contents() vai file(). A nafig tev?
  3. Pievieno vēl line-height: ??px; css-am. Kādus 25px. Pēc ieskatījuma.
  4. Ja vēlies, lai IE lapa attēlotos normāli, aizmirsti par CSS validāciju vai arī par caurspīdīgiem elementiem un atteliem (png).
  5. GedroX

    myltipart post

    "/9j/4AAQSkZJRgABAQAAAQABAAD" - tas arī izskatās pēc normāla base64 kodējuma. "GIF89ax Õ k5'??Öf??y?©?FI#R(" toč nebūs base64, bet binary. Ja tev vajaga mail-am, tad izmanto gatavas klases, peimēram PEAR Mail klasi.
  6. Nē. Tu teici "nevar." =) Whatever. Tas ir tāds geeky veids, bet pieņemams tikai maziem attēliem. Priekš security image šis variants varētu būt ok, jo tas ir tāds kā mandatory attēls.
  7. Var! Skat http://www.elf.org/essay/inline-image.html Piemēram <img src="data:image/gif;base64,R0lGODlhIAAgAGYAACH5BAEAAEwALAAAAAAgACAAhgAAAPbdAKCQAP//o/TcAN/JAO3VANK9AOLLAM+5AOLMAOXOANTAAPDYAOzVANzGAPHZAMu4AOnTANnDAPPbAOnSAOXPAOrTAMm2ANvFAOvUAEE7AObPAO7WAO7XAPbcAPDZAMazANvGAO/XADs1AKaWAN7IANfCANjDAPXdAH9yAO3WAFBIAEI7APLZAPLaAKmZAPXcAIF0AKSTAOTLAIB0AOfQANzFANS/ANjCAPTbAOvTANbCAOzTAPHYAOPMAHFmAPPZADk0AMOwAPLYAGVbAEI8AO3UAO/YAOHLADo0AHJmA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Af/gEyCg4SFhoeIiYIAio2JAJCOkoOQA5GTjZUBloyYiJUEoZyehqAEAaijpIsAA6GnqJuXnqaoBrGynZOVFLApuKmzma0QoSkfQEZLH7iqipUGBDojIC4tAC1BIMzBuofQBgYeDQ0QGwAbEC8EMbHOheDhKyPk5+kQLkSvBO+sAw4AARpY4cEDCwAsyDXw8YKCQwrvKkmYOFGDRYA1AMjowLGDByQNQECAoAqSgAUoUfaowLKCBBUAVOy4QJOmhiPhDAi4ZBKBzwoLLAgVCgMADBscknJAScPnTm8mCyzwqaBq1RIASvywqgBBEgQ6hbESUKCsWbMzzpo1YeLpJwACZDKIeEA3Q4YiJEhkoEv3hgi3j+CiyDEBxQkeSiCdmMCYMeBncHEwmMxACCTKkx8PE3Cgs+fPBzQ7MpmgtGnToiWZjMC6dYTUu+BimD0bNiaTIXLbpgV3yG5SJsWugid8ODxPgQAAOw==" /> P.S. Protams, ka nav īpaši labi to darīt un kategoriski aizliegts to pielietot parastiem attēliem. Lietotājam vairs nav izvēles lejuplādēt attēlus vai nē, jo tie atnāk kopā ar source-u. P.S.S. Oops... IE neņem pretī... :( Risinājums dean.edwards lapā
  8. Varbūt šis ir tāds paslikts piemērs, bet doma ir akceptējama. Labāks piemērs būtu php funkcija usort(), kurai arī var definēt tādu kā handler-i, šajā gadījumā salīdzinošo funkciju, kura pasaka, kurš no diviem elementiem ir lielāks, bet visus elementus sakārto pati.
  9. $fp = fopen("links.txt", "r"); while (!feof($fp)) { $link = fgets($fp, 500); if($link) { $links[$n] = rtrim($link); $n++; } } fclose($fp); vietā raksti $links = array_reverse(file("links.txt")); Un vēl, lai izmestu tukšās rindas, raksti foreach ($links as $k => $v) { $links[$k] = trim($links[$k]); if (!links[$k]) unset($links[$k]) }
  10. Nu pievieno taču extension-u gd2 iekš php.ini.
  11. Cik sapratu, tev vajaga šo: <?php $dati = Array('krasa' => 'balta', 'augstums' => 195); $variablji = Array('krasa', 'augstums'); foreach ( $variablji as $t ) { $n = $t . "x"; $$n = $dati[$t]; echo '$' . $n . ' = '; echo $$n . '; '; } echo '<br />'; echo $krasax; ?>
  12. SELECT name, COUNT(name) as c FROM table GROUP BY name ORDER BY c DESC LIMIT 1
  13. Kā arī teicu - īsti neizlasīju. =)
  14. Īsti nelasīju, bet izskatās, ka tas, ko tev vajaga - http://blog.joshuaeichorn.com/archives/200...pload-progress/
  15. Visvienkāršākais ir izmantot csv. Par XLS faila nolasīšanu gan īsti nezinu. Kautkad šī tēma šajā forumā tika skarta.
  16. Mēģini tā: mysql_query('UPDATE private SET text="' . addslashes($text) . '", mod="' . addslashes($mod) . '" where id=' . (int)$id); Ja nepalīdz, tad apskaties, vai vispār pie mysql konektējas un uztaisi šim qurijam echo un iesveid to pa taisno MySQL. Vai tad tik grūti ir debagot savu kodu? :)
  17. Nu ja ierakstu skaits nepārsniedz dažus tūkstošus, droši var izmantot ORDER BY RAND() LIMIT <vēlamo_ierakstu_skaits>, bet lielām tabulām v3rb0 variants laikam ir labākais.
  18. Nu tieši tādēļ, ka tips ir unsigned. Un 36893488147419102732 + 500 = 2^65.
  19. Šis neiet? $a1 = '/([\'][^\']*[\'])|(["][^"]*["])|([`][^`]*[`])/'; $a2='<font style="color: red;">\\0</font>'; $strings=preg_replace($a1,$a2,$string);
  20. http://www.htmlcenter.com/tutorials/tutorials.cfm/155/PHP/ jeb atslēgvārdi "cron php"
  21. Tiek meklēts nopietns PHP programmētājs nopietnām un ilglaicīgām attiecībām. Sīkāka informācija http://www.videinfra.com/company/about/vacancies/programmer/ PM
  22. Skatos, ka vārda brīvība šajā forumā nav sveša!!! =D P.S. Iepriekšējie mani posti tika izdzēsti. Es nelamājos, tikai izteicu savu visnotaļ subjektīvo viedokli. Cik saprotu, projekts ir īstermiņa? Kāds laika intervāls? Kāda samaksa (kārta)?
  23. GedroX

    Piedāvā darbu

    Hotmail-am ir draņķīgākā Junk mail filtrācija, kāda vispār ir piedzīvota. Iemet, kā izskatās sūtītais mails. Parasti mail source var redzēt, par ko tas ir ieguvis spama punktus. :)
  24. Es teiktu, ka kautkāds advertisment blokeris... ne? (Zone Alarm, teiksim..)
×
×
  • Create New...